Lucky Draw抽奖系统:5分钟快速搭建企业年会抽奖程序
【免费下载链接】lucky-draw年会抽奖程序项目地址: https://gitcode.com/gh_mirrors/lu/lucky-draw
还在为年会抽奖环节发愁吗?Lucky Draw前端抽奖应用帮你解决所有烦恼!这款基于Vue.js开发的轻量级抽奖系统,不仅界面精美、操作简单,更重要的是能够为你的企业活动增添专业感和科技氛围。
🎉 为什么选择Lucky Draw?
专业级视觉效果
内置多款精心设计的背景图片,从深邃的科技蓝到神秘的暗金网格,每一款都能为抽奖环节营造出独特的仪式感。
数据安全无忧
采用浏览器内置的IndexedDB技术存储所有抽奖数据,中奖记录在本地安全保存,即使页面刷新也不会丢失重要信息。
灵活配置方案
无论你是小型团队活动还是大型企业年会,Lucky Draw都能完美适配:
- 10-50人小型活动:单次抽取1-3名中奖者
- 100-1000人大型年会:支持多轮抽奖、分级奖品设置
🚀 快速启动指南
环境要求
- Node.js 14.0+
- npm 6.0+
三步完成部署
- 获取源代码
git clone https://gitcode.com/gh_mirrors/lu/lucky-draw cd lucky-draw- 安装依赖包
npm install- 启动抽奖服务
npm run serve访问http://localhost:8080即可进入专业抽奖界面!
⚙️ 核心功能详解
智能抽奖算法
基于src/helper/algorithm.js的随机算法,确保每次抽奖的公平性和随机性,已中奖人员自动排除,避免重复获奖。
可视化配置界面
通过src/components/LotteryConfig.vue组件,你可以轻松设置:
- 参与抽奖总人数
- 每轮中奖名额
- 抽奖动画效果
- 背景音乐选择
实时结果展示
src/components/Result.vue组件负责中奖结果的实时显示和记录管理,让整个抽奖过程透明公正。
📋 实战操作手册
活动前准备
✅系统测试:提前完成部署和功能测试
✅参数配置:根据活动规模设置合适的抽奖规则
✅名单准备:整理参与者信息和奖品清单
✅人员培训:安排操作人员熟悉系统流程
活动执行流程
- 打开抽奖系统主界面
- 导入或输入参与者名单
- 设置抽奖轮次和奖品等级
- 启动抽奖,实时展示结果
- 保存并导出中奖记录
🔧 常见问题解决方案
依赖安装失败
npm cache clean --force npm install界面显示异常
- 检查浏览器兼容性
- 确认Element UI组件库正确安装
- 清理浏览器缓存重新加载
数据备份策略
重要活动前建议导出中奖记录作为备份,确保数据安全。
💡 进阶使用技巧
性能优化建议
- 大型活动:超过500人的抽奖建议分批进行
- 浏览器选择:推荐使用Chrome、Firefox等现代浏览器
- 网络环境:确保稳定的网络连接
功能扩展思路
虽然Lucky Draw已经功能完善,但你还可以考虑:
- 多等级奖品管理系统
- Excel格式名单批量导入
- 抽奖结果打印功能
- 历史记录查询模块
🎯 总结与展望
Lucky Draw抽奖系统以其专业的外观、稳定的性能和简单的操作,成为了企业年会抽奖环节的理想选择。无论你是技术新手还是资深开发者,都能在5分钟内完成部署,立即享受专业级抽奖体验!
通过合理的配置和操作,这款抽奖系统不仅能够提升活动的专业度,更能为参与者带来难忘的抽奖体验。现在就动手试试吧,让你的下一次企业活动更加精彩纷呈!
【免费下载链接】lucky-draw年会抽奖程序项目地址: https://gitcode.com/gh_mirrors/lu/lucky-draw
创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考